Heim  >  Fragen und Antworten  >  Hauptteil

javascript - Unterstützt die AntDesign Select-Komponente benutzerdefinierte Eingaben (mode="tags"), die einen Fehler melden?

Wenn Sie die ausgewählte Komponente von antdesign verwenden, müssen Sie die Support-Eingabefunktion verwenden. Laut Dokument fügen Sie das Attribut mode="tags" hinzu und der Schlüsselwert wird ebenfalls zur Option hinzugefügt, es wird jedoch weiterhin ein Fehler gemeldet . Hier ist mein Code:

    

<FormItem label="请输入版本号">
          {
            getFieldDecorator('appversion', {initialValue: ''})(
              <Select mode="tags" style={{ width: '140px' }}>
                { this.state.appverCodeList }
              </Select>
            )
          }
        </FormItem>
        
        const appverCodeList = res.map((item) => {
            return(
                <Option value={item.key.toString()} key={item.key.toString(){item.value } </Option>
              )
            })
        this.setState({ appverCodeList })
        
        

Fehlermeldung: Nicht erfasster Fehler: Schlüssel für <rc-animate> muss festgelegt werden

天蓬老师天蓬老师2711 Tage vor1076

Antworte allen(2)Ich werde antworten

  • 高洛峰

    高洛峰2017-05-19 10:13:13

    这是最诡异的BUG了,期待大神解读

    Antwort
    0
  • 伊谢尔伦

    伊谢尔伦2017-05-19 10:13:13

    <Option value={item.key.toString()} key={item.key.toString(){item.value } </Option>
    你不是这里写错了,应该是这样的吧:
    <Option value={item.key.toString()} key={item.key.toString()}>{item.value } </Option>

    Antwort
    0
  • StornierenAntwort